Output 96ea33ae68b0f35a5afb3612f9eef755f892a9fabe4a2aa4808c0e012ca916ed:0

value
32506424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eec4ecfcb32bc52fb934dbbb17698178f7c3665e OP_EQUAL
address
MVfexj2n8tpWZa5B7zvBJuVhNZfPcPjmM5
transaction
96ea33ae68b0f35a5afb3612f9eef755f892a9fabe4a2aa4808c0e012ca916ed
spent
true